Saxophones are cool, saxophones are stylish. They use a single reed like a clarinet and the instrument was invented in 1841 in Belgium by Adolphe Sax. They come in a range of sizes related to key pitch. The Sopranini is small and looks more like a clarinet than the traditional curvy saxophone, on the other hand the contra bass is huge making an adult look like a small child when holding it! The most familiar versions are the tenor an alto saxes, and whilst they are most frequently made of brass, there are plastic and even bamboo models.

Sax Stars
- Charlie Parker
- Nicknamed Bird, or Yardbird. American jazz saxophonist and composer.
- John Coltrane
- Nicknamed Trane and made a saint by the African Orthodox Church as Saint John William Coltrane.
- Lester Young
- Nicknamed "Prez". He played with Count Bassie
- Coleman Hawkins
- The first important jazz musician to use the instrument
- Sonny Rollins
- Theodore Walter "Sonny" Rollins. Born in New York City September 7, 1930
- Eric Dolphy
- Born in Los Angeles. Highly improvisational style.
- Cannonball Adderley
- Julian Edwin "Cannonball" Adderley
- Wayne Shorter
- Born in Newark, New Jersey,
- Stanley Turrentine
- Known as "Mr. T" or "The Sugar Man",
- Dexter Gordon
- Known as 'Long Tall Dexter' and 'Sophisticated Giant
